cpp-SPARTA基于抽象解释的高性能静态代码分析器

时间:2022-09-04 05:23:40
【文件属性】:

文件名称:cpp-SPARTA基于抽象解释的高性能静态代码分析器

文件大小:158KB

文件格式:ZIP

更新时间:2022-09-04 05:23:40

C/C 开发-静态代码分析

SPARTA is a library that provides the basic blocks for building high-performance static code analyzers based on Abstract Interpretation.


【文件预览】:
SPARTA-master
----test()
--------PatriciaTreeMapTest.cpp(3KB)
--------HashedAbstractEnvironmentTest.cpp(6KB)
--------DisjointUnionAbstractDomainTest.cpp(2KB)
--------HashedSetAbstractDomainTest.cpp(4KB)
--------PatriciaTreeMapAbstractEnvironmentTest.cpp(9KB)
--------SparseSetAbstractDomainTest.cpp(4KB)
--------S_ExpressionTest.cpp(8KB)
--------ReducedProductAbstractDomainTest.cpp(6KB)
--------WeakTopologicalOrderingTest.cpp(7KB)
--------AbstractDomainPropertyTest.h(6KB)
--------FiniteAbstractDomainTest.cpp(4KB)
--------MonotonicFixpointIteratorTest.cpp(13KB)
--------PatriciaTreeSetTest.cpp(9KB)
--------PatriciaTreeSetAbstractDomainTest.cpp(6KB)
--------HashedAbstractPartitionTest.cpp(6KB)
--------PatriciaTreeMapAbstractPartitionTest.cpp(5KB)
----get_boost.sh(217B)
----include()
--------S_Expression.h(24KB)
--------SparseSetAbstractDomain.h(7KB)
--------WeakTopologicalOrdering.h(11KB)
--------FixpointIterator.h(5KB)
--------PatriciaTreeSet.h(31KB)
--------PatriciaTreeMapAbstractPartition.h(6KB)
--------PatriciaTreeMapAbstractEnvironment.h(9KB)
--------PatriciaTreeMap.h(36KB)
--------FiniteAbstractDomain.h(19KB)
--------Exceptions.h(1KB)
--------DisjointUnionAbstractDomain.h(10KB)
--------PatriciaTreeUtil.h(920B)
--------PatriciaTreeSetAbstractDomain.h(4KB)
--------ReducedProductAbstractDomain.h(13KB)
--------MonotonicFixpointIterator.h(12KB)
--------AbstractDomain.h(21KB)
--------PowersetAbstractDomain.h(6KB)
--------ConstantAbstractDomain.h(4KB)
--------HashedAbstractPartition.h(8KB)
--------HashedSetAbstractDomain.h(4KB)
--------HashedAbstractEnvironment.h(12KB)
----LICENSE(1KB)
----CONTRIBUTING.md(2KB)
----cmake_modules()
--------Commons.cmake(4KB)
--------gtest.cmake.in(361B)
----SPARTA.png(74KB)
----.clang-format(1KB)
----.gitignore(86B)
----CMakeLists.txt(2KB)
----CODE_OF_CONDUCT.md(249B)
----README.md(5KB)

网友评论